Transaction d786e75100e7ab62abc2c2a5534638c91df71aef705c0270ae1a6834bb38605f
1 Input
1 Output
-
d786e75100e7ab62abc2c2a5534638c91df71aef705c0270ae1a6834bb38605f:0
- value
- 425138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3072984c9346eda71caaf85284f462e300b67ab5 OP_EQUAL
- address
- 367Bdwq3oa5ZnbGpWe41JxFw35XT3Ff14H